filebeam

P2P file transfer using simple codes. Built on hyperbeam.

npm install filebeam

Usage

Send files:

import Filebeam from 'filebeam'

const beam = new Filebeam()

console.log('Code:', beam.code) // share this

await beam.ready()

beam.send([
  { path: '/absolute/path/to/file.txt', name: 'file.txt' },
  { path: '/absolute/path/to/photo.jpg', name: 'photo.jpg' }
])

beam.on('connected', () => console.log('connected'))
beam.on('end', () => beam.destroy())

Receive files:

import Filebeam from 'filebeam'

const beam = new Filebeam('ABC123XYZ') // code from sender

beam.setDownloadLocation('./downloads') // optional, defaults to ~/Downloads

await beam.ready()

beam.startReceive()

beam.on('connected', () => console.log('connected'))
beam.on('data', (chunk) => console.log('received', chunk.length, 'bytes'))
beam.on('end', () => beam.destroy())

API

const beam = new Filebeam([code])

Create a new instance. Omit code to create a sender (generates code automatically).

beam.code

The pairing code.

beam.sender

Boolean. true if sender, false if receiver.

await beam.ready()

Wait until connected to DHT.

beam.send(files)

Send files. files is an array of { path, name } objects.

Sender only.

beam.startReceive()

Start receiving files.

Receiver only.

beam.setDownloadLocation(dir)

Set download directory. Call before startReceive().

Receiver only.

beam.destroy()

Close connection.

Events

beam.on('connected', fn)

Emitted when peers connect.

beam.on('data', fn)

Emitted on incoming data chunks.

Receiver only.

beam.on('end', fn)

Emitted when transfer completes.

beam.on('error', fn)

Emitted on errors.

How it works

Sender generates a random code, hashes it to derive a key, and announces on the DHT. Receiver uses the same code to derive the same key and connect. Files are streamed as a tar archive over the encrypted hyperbeam connection.
